A molecular pathway analysis informs the genetic background at risk for schizophrenia.
Progress in neuro-psychopharmacology & biological psychiatry - 3 Jun 2015
Crisafulli Concetta, Drago Antonio, Calabrò Marco, Spina Edoardo, Serretti Alessandro
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Schizophrenia is a complex mental disorder marked by severely impaired thinking, delusional thoughts, hallucinations and poor emotional responsiveness. The biological mechanisms that lead to schizophrenia may be related to the genetic background of patients. Thus, a genetic perspective may help to unravel the molecular pathways disrupted in schizophrenia. METHODS: In the present work, we used a...
